实现ASP.NET GRIDVIEW固定表头与列的技术分享

下载需积分: 16 | RAR格式 | 233KB | 更新于2025-03-07 | 18 浏览量 | 10 下载量 举报
收藏
ASP.NET是.NET Framework的一部分,它是一个用于构建动态网页、网络应用程序和服务的平台。该平台使用C#或VB.NET等语言编写,能够在服务器端运行,并生成HTML页面发送给客户端浏览器。在ASP.NET中,数据展示是一个常见的任务,开发者经常需要展示大量数据,以便用户可以快速地浏览和管理这些信息。GRIDVIEW是ASP.NET中用于展示数据的一个强大控件,它可以绑定数据源并以网格形式显示。然而,在用户滚动表格时,默认情况下列标题也会随着滚动而消失,这可能会导致用户难以跟踪他们正在查看的数据列。因此,实现固定标题列与栏位的功能变得尤为重要。 在本例中,描述提到的是如何在使用ASP.NET的GRIDVIEW控件时固定标题列和栏位。为了解决这一问题,开发者通常会使用JavaScript或jQuery等客户端脚本语言,以及可能的CSS样式来实现这一效果,使得即便在用户向下滚动查看数据时,列标题依然固定在浏览器窗口的顶部。 JQUERY UI是一个基于jQuery的JavaScript库,它提供了一套丰富的用户界面功能,包括一些用于增强用户交互体验的组件,例如,它包含用于创建拖放操作、添加日期选择器、创建滑动条、弹出窗口以及提供表单验证等功能。在处理固定标题列和栏位的需求时,开发者可能会利用JQUERY UI提供的某些功能或组件来辅助实现滚动效果。 从提供的文件名称列表"GridViewScroll"可以推测,文件中可能包含实现滚动固定标题列和栏位的具体代码示例。由于下载的资源中提到包含有博客文章的说明链接,该链接指向的博客文章应该提供了详细的步骤和代码示例,以说明如何在ASP.NET的GRIDVIEW控件中实现固定标题列和栏位。 在实际操作中,开发者会首先需要了解GRIDVIEW控件的基本使用方法,然后学习如何通过客户端脚本控制HTML元素的行为,包括如何使用CSS来设置样式,以及如何使用JavaScript或jQuery来动态控制页面元素的显示。通常,固定列标题的实现需要使用到CSS的position属性,并将标题设置为position: fixed,这样就可以保证标题在滚动时能够固定在页面的顶部。而固定栏位的实现可能涉及到捕获滚动事件,并动态地修改行的位置。 总结来说,在ASP.NET中使用GRIDVIEW控件实现固定标题列与栏位的功能,需要开发者具备HTML、CSS、JavaScript以及ASP.NET控件绑定的知识。通过合适的代码编写与样式设计,可以实现一个在用户体验上更为友好的表格显示,使得用户即使在查看大量数据时也能够清楚地知道每一列数据的意义,从而提高工作效率。

相关推荐

luohai326
  • 粉丝: 47
上传资源 快速赚钱